Liverpool boss Brendan Rodgers is delighted with his side's 1-1 draw at Chelsea on Sunday.

Liverpool manager Brendan Rodgers has described his side's 1-1 draw at Chelsea on Sunday as a "great result".

The Reds were behind at the break at Stamford Bridge when John Terry nodded in from a corner, but they earned a share of the spoils thanks to Luis Suarez's header.

"Coming here is very difficult and with the group that we're working with at the moment it was a great result," Rodgers told BBC Sport.

"Our senior players are being phenomenal at the moment and our young players are getting great experience. If we can add one or two in the coming months, we can turn these draws into wins."

Sunday's point has kept the Merseysiders in 13th place in the Premier League table.
